What opportunities and challenges will design managers be faced with next year? The annual Design Management Institute (DMI) Conference from April 21 – 22, 2010 will address this question.
The Boston-based DMI is a non-profit organization and has been offering conferences, seminars, member events and publications since 1975. It aims to increase people’s awareness that design is a key component of good business strategies. With its activities, the Institute brings together creative professionals from all design fields, businesspeople, academic institutions, and private and state companies.
Last year the conference was held in Milan. In 2010, it will take place in London’s West End. The event will be headed by Oliver King (co-founder of the consulting firm Engine Service Design) and Clive Grinyer (Head of Customer Experience, Cisco Internet Business Solutions Group).
